Overview
The Rogue 25MM IWF Olympic Weightlifting Bar is an elite-level women’s 15KG bearing bar officially approved by the International Weightlifting Federation (IWF). Fully machined and assembled in Columbus, Ohio, this bar is engineered to provide the precision "whip" and high-speed "spin" required for competitive snatch and clean & jerk. Featuring high-grade 215K PSI tensile strength steel and a 10-needle bearing rotation system, it represents the gold standard for women's Olympic training and competition.

Key Features & Specifications
Certification: IWF Approved for competitive use.
Shaft Diameter: 25mm (Women's standard).
Weight: 15KG.
Tensile Strength: 215,000 PSI (Individually tested and straightened to within 0.015”).
Rotation System: 10 sets of high-quality needle bearings (5 per sleeve).
Shaft/Sleeve Finish: Bright Zinc—provides reliable oxidation resistance and a classic silver look.
Knurling: Full but minimally aggressive Olympic knurl marks (Standard women's pattern).
Center Knurl: No. Ideal for high-rep cleans and front squats to protect the skin on the collarbone.
Sleeve Design: Single-piece construction with friction-welded collars.
Loadable Sleeve Length: 12.50".
Durability Rating: F6-R (Treated with patented Rogue Work Hardening).
Origin: Made in the USA with US and EU Steel.
Performance Benefits
IWF Approved: Meets the strict dimensions, weight tolerances, and performance standards of the International Weightlifting Federation. Each bar features IWF branding on the shaft and machined endcaps.
Elite Spin: The 10-needle bearing system provides a smooth, silent rotation that is critical for reducing torque on the wrists during rapid Olympic transitions.
Engineered Whip: The 215K PSI steel alloy is chosen specifically to provide the necessary "flex" or "whip" required for the catch phase of the lift.
Quiet Stability: Tighter connection tolerances and single-piece sleeves dampen sound and eliminate unwanted radial float.
Maintenance and Care
Zinc-finished bearing bars require specific care to maintain their appearance and high-performance rotation.
Knurl Cleaning: Regularly use a nylon bristle brush to clear chalk, sweat, and debris from the knurling.
Lubrication: To keep the needle bearings spinning smoothly, apply a few drops of 3-in-1 oil or high-quality light machine oil to the sleeve interface periodically. Spin the sleeves to distribute the oil.
Rust Prevention: Zinc is resistant to rust but not immune. Periodically wipe the shaft and sleeves with a light coat of 3-in-1 oil and wipe dry to preserve the finish, especially in humid or garage gym settings.
Protection: Metal-to-metal contact with plates and J-cups will show wear over time. Rogue recommends using J-cups with plastic liners to preserve the bright zinc aesthetic.
Warranty Information
The Rogue 25MM IWF Olympic Weightlifting Bar is backed by a Lifetime Warranty against construction defects and bending.
Coverage: Covers the original purchaser against material and workmanship defects.
Exclusions: Does not cover normal finish wear or damage caused by negligence (e.g., dropping the bar on a bench, spotter arms, or iron plates).
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Is this bar suitable for CrossFit? A: Yes, but bearing bars are highly specialized for Olympic lifting. For high-volume CrossFit workouts involving varied movements (squats, presses, etc.), the Rogue Bella Bar (bushing system) is often a more durable and cost-effective choice.
Q: Can I rack this bar in a standard power rack? A: Yes. With a 51.5" distance between the sleeves, it is compatible with all standard-width power racks, squat stands, and rigs.
Q: What is the F-Rating? A: The F-Rating (F6-R) represents the bar's resistance to fatigue. This bar is rated to last over 12 years in a high-volume facility and a lifetime in a home gym.
Q: How do I identify the IWF version? A: This bar features official IWF branding centralized on the shaft, an official IWF sticker, and machined stainless steel endcaps with IWF logos.
